A renowned media brand seeks an experienced associate editor to join their team. This role involves pitching ideas, reporting, editing, and managing the digital output for all content.
Candidates should have four to six years of editorial experience, a strong passion for design and fashion, and the ability to thrive in a fast-paced environment.
The position offers appealing benefits including discounts at the café, health insurance, and generous leave days, based in the vibrant Marylebone office.

How to prepare for a job interview at Monocle
✨Know Your Fashion and Design Trends
Make sure you’re up to date with the latest trends in fashion and design. Research recent collections, influential designers, and digital content strategies. This will not only show your passion but also demonstrate your expertise during the interview.
✨Prepare Your Pitch Ideas
Think of a few unique pitch ideas that align with the brand's voice and audience. Be ready to discuss how these ideas can enhance their digital output. This shows initiative and creativity, which are key for a Senior Associate Editor role.
✨Showcase Your Editorial Experience
Be prepared to discuss specific examples from your previous roles where you successfully managed editorial projects or led a team. Highlight your ability to thrive in fast-paced environments by sharing stories that illustrate your problem-solving skills and adaptability.
✨Ask Insightful Questions
Prepare thoughtful questions about the company’s vision, team dynamics, and future projects. This not only shows your interest in the role but also helps you gauge if the company culture aligns with your values and work style.
